Ohio mayor and county day facts

The Mayor and County Recognition Day for National Service is a nationwide bipartisan effort to recognize the positive impact of national service, to thank those who serve, and to encourage citizens to give back to their communities.

Mayors, city council members, county officials, county board chairs, and  tribal leaders, participate in this day to spotlight the key role that national service plays in helping counties and cities solve problems.

Led by the Corporation for National & Community Service, AmeriCorps members and Senior Corps volunteers are given special recognition for their service to communities.

In Ohio that includes 7,084 AmeriCorps members and Senior Corps volunteers serving at 1,813 local service sites.

Ohio Mayors and Elected Officials Recognize National Service Members and Volunteers

On April 4, 2017, 81 mayors, county commissioners, and other elected officials across Ohio joined more than 4,500 elected officials across the country to thank those who serve.

 Some of Ohio’s largest events took place in Cincinnati, Columbus, and Washington County. In SW Ohio, Mayor Whaley and Commissioner Foley came together for a joint celebration of national service in Dayton and Montgomery County; a group of Foster Grandparent volunteers were honored to sing the national anthem at the event.  Other celebration activities across the state included visiting national service programs, hosting roundtables, issuing proclamations, and communicating about national service through social media. By shining the spotlight on the impact of service and thanking those who serve, local officials hoped to inspire more residents to get involved in their communities.
